Latest Patents

Tateishi's latest patents include a board design assistance device and a communication apparatus with a communication rate selecting method. The board design assistance device is designed to acquire design data for printed circuit boards. It features a first determiner that checks if the board fiber's lengthwise direction is perpendicular to the electronic component's longitudinal direction. Additionally, it includes a notifier that provides error notifications for any discrepancies found. The communication apparatus patent focuses on selecting communication rates at high speeds while ensuring increased reliability. It includes mechanisms for detecting and notifying TCH numbers assigned by base stations, allowing for efficient communication rate switching.
